Monthly climate in Maillat, France

Last updated: July 31, 2025

Under the Köppen–Geiger climate classification Maillat features a oceanic climate (Cfb). Temperatures typically range between 2 °C (36 °F) and 21 °C (70 °F) through the year, but rarely can drop to -14 °C (8 °F) or can rise to as high as 38 °C (100 °F). The average annual precipitation amounts to about 1496 mm (58.9 inches) and receives 154 rainy days on the 1 mm (0.04 inches) threshold annually. Maillat enjoys an average of 3473 hours of sunshine throughout the year, and daylight varies from 8 hours 40 minutes to 15 hours 41 minutes per day.

Monthly average temperatures in Maillat, France

The warmest months in Maillat are June, July and August, with daily mean temperatures ranging from 19 to 21 °C (66 - 70 °F) throughout the day. The coldest temperatures usually occur in January, February and December, when daily mean temperatures range from 2 to 5 °C (36 - 42 °F) throughout the day. On average each year, Maillat experiences 51 days above 25 °C (77.0 °F) and 50 days below 0 °C (32.0 °F).

Monthly average precipitation in Maillat, France

Maillat usually has the most precipitation in March, May and December, with an average of 16 rainy days and 179 mm (7.1 inches) of precipitation per month. The driest months in Maillat are April, August and September. On average, 80 mm (3.1 inches) of precipitation falls during these months.

Monthly sunshine hours in Maillat, France

The sunniest months in Maillat are June, July and August, when the sun shines an average of 12 hours 56 minutes a day. Least sunny months in Maillat: January, November and December receive an average of 5 hours 23 minutes of sunshine daily.

Solar UV radiation in Maillat, France

Maillat experiences the highest level of ultraviolet (UV) radiation in June, July and August, when the maximum UV index can reach values of 8 - 10, which corresponds to the Very High category of sun exposure. January, February and December are in the Low / Moderate exposure category. In these months, the maximum values of the UV index do not exceed 3.
